Catherine Hardwicke to Direct The Girl With the Red Riding Hood

Catherine Hardwicke knows what works for her.

The Twilight director - who is at least partially responsible for Robert Pattinson and his rise to stardom - has signed on her next project... and it's remarkably similar to her previous project!

Hardwicke will direct The Girl With the Red Riding Hood, a big screen adaption of the classic fairy tale.

The film will center on werewolves and - wouldn't you know it! - a teenage love triangle. No production date has been set yet.

Catherine Hardwicke Reveals Twilight Casting Scoop

Attention, Twilight Saga fans:

Prior to this week's Teen Choice Awards, director Catherine Hardwicke revealed a rather juicy bit of news:

It turns out that Bryce Dallas Howard - who will replace Rachelle Lefevre in the role of Victoria for Eclipse - was the director's first choice for that character.

However, Howard balked because she considered the role too minor at the time. With Victoria featured prominently in Eclipse, the actress was glad to accept.

Catherine Hardwicke: Fired from New Moon!

Startling news out of the Twilight world today:

Director Catherine Hardwicke will reportedly NOT be asked to helm the film's sequel, New Moon.

According to Deadline Hollywood, Hardwicke “was difficult and irrational during the making of Twilight.” 

The franchise, which has already accrued over $160 million and is headlined by Robert Pattinson and Kristen Stewart, will not seek a new director for its next two films.

"I am sorry that due to timing I will not have the opportunity to direct New Moon," said Hardwicke. "Directing Twilight has been one of the great experiences of my life, and I am grateful to the fans for their passionate support of the film. I wish everyone at Summit the best with the sequel -- it is a great story."

Catherine Hardwicke: New Moon is Up My Alley

Twilight director Catherine Hardwick has not officially signed on for the upcoming movie version of New Moon.

But her thoughts about the project, given in a new interview, make it as close to a done deal as possible that the director will be on board:

New Moon's really taking a whole other leap with this new story and there's really a lot of new characters in it. There's the werewolves which is pretty crazy. All the wolves. Then there's also going to Italy in the second book and there's motorcycle riding and cliff-jumping and diving.

I love jumping off of cliffs. So it's kind of up my alley – into water, yeah.
